Serentica Renewables has signed a Power Supply and Consumption Agreement (PSCA) with INOX Air Products (INOXAP), a leading Indian manufacturer of industrial, electronic, and medical gases.
Under the agreement, Serentica will supply 75 MW of hybrid renewable energy—comprising wind, solar, and storage—via an inter-state transmission system (ISTS) project. This clean energy will power four of INOXAP’s key manufacturing facilities across different states, significantly increasing the company’s renewable energy usage.
The round-the-clock hybrid energy solution enables flexible allocation across multiple sites, supporting INOXAP’s progress toward its net-zero goals. The partnership represents a major milestone in INOXAP’s decarbonisation efforts and aligns with India’s broader climate objectives.
This initiative is part of Serentica’s mission to accelerate the energy transition in hard-to-abate sectors.
